SECTION 5 — WARRANTIES
5.1 Warranty Selection. Seller makes the following warranty election regarding the Property (select one):
☐ AS-IS, WHERE-IS (No Warranty). THE PROPERTY IS SOLD "AS-IS, WHERE-IS" WITH ALL FAULTS. SELLER MAKES NO WARRANTIES, EXPRESS OR IMPLIED, REGARDING THE PROPERTY, INCLUDING WITHOUT LIMITATION THE IMPLIED WARRANTIES OF MERCHANTABILITY (ALA. CODE § 7-2-314), F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E (ALA. CODE § 7-2-315), OR ANY WARRANTY ARISING FROM COURSE OF DEALING, USAGE OF TRADE, OR COURSE OF PERFORMANCE. BUYER ACKNOWLEDGES THAT BUYER HAS INSPECTED THE PROPERTY OR HAS HAD THE OPPORTUNITY TO INSPECT THE PROPERTY AND ACCEPTS IT IN ITS PRESENT CONDITION. THIS DISCLAIMER IS MADE IN COMPLIANCE WITH ALA. CODE § 7-2-316.
☐ Express Warranty. Seller warrants the following regarding the Property (describe warranty terms, duration, and limitations): [________________________________]
Duration of express warranty: [________________________________] from date of sale.
☐ Implied Warranty of Title (UCC § 2-312). Seller warrants, pursuant to Ala. Code § 7-2-312, that: (a) the title conveyed shall be good, and its transfer rightful; (b) the Property shall be delivered free from any security interest or other lien or encumbrance of which the Buyer at the time of contracting has no knowledge; and (c) the Property is free from any rightful claim of infringement.
☐ Full Warranty (Express + Implied). Seller provides both express warranties as described above and all implied warranties under Alabama UCC Article 2, including the implied warranty of merchantability (Ala. Code § 7-2-314) and the implied warranty of fitness for a particular purpose (Ala. Code § 7-2-315).

PRACTICE NOTES — ALABAMA-SPECIFIC REQUIREMENTS
-
UCC Article 2 Applicability. Alabama has adopted UCC Article 2 (Ala. Code § 7-2-101 et seq.), which governs the sale of goods (movable personal property). The bill of sale serves as evidence of the transaction and the transfer of title.
-
Statute of Frauds. Under Ala. Code § 7-2-201, contracts for the sale of goods priced at $500 or more must be evidenced by a writing signed by the party against whom enforcement is sought. This Bill of Sale satisfies that requirement.
-
Title Transfer. Under Ala. Code § 7-2-401, title to goods passes from seller to buyer at the time and place the seller completes physical delivery of the goods, unless the parties expressly agree otherwise.
-
Warranty Disclaimer Requirements. Under Ala. Code § 7-2-316, to exclude the implied warranty of merchantability, the disclaimer must mention "merchantability" and, if in writing, must be conspicuous. To exclude the implied warranty of fitness for a particular purpose, the exclusion must be in writing and conspicuous.
-
Motor Vehicle Requirements. For motor vehicle transfers, Alabama requires submission of the signed title and bill of sale to the Alabama Department of Revenue, Motor Vehicle Division. Per Ala. Admin. Code r. 810-5-1-.246, the bill of sale must contain specified minimum information. Vehicles subject to the Alabama Certificate of Title and Antitheft Act (Ala. Code § 32-8-1 et seq.) require title transfer through the county probate judge or license commissioner.
-
Sales Tax. Alabama imposes a state sales/use tax on the sale of tangible personal property. Buyers should verify tax obligations with the Alabama Department of Revenue. Certain exemptions may apply (e.g., casual sales between individuals for certain items).
-
Odometer Disclosure. Federal law (49 U.S.C. § 32703) and Alabama regulations require odometer disclosure for motor vehicle transfers. Failure to provide accurate odometer information may result in civil and criminal penalties.
-
Notarization. Alabama does not generally require notarization for bills of sale, but notarization is recommended for high-value transactions and may be required by the purchaser's lender or for certain property types.
-
Risk of Loss. Under Ala. Code § 7-2-509, in the absence of breach, risk of loss passes to the buyer upon receipt of the goods if the seller is a merchant, or upon tender of delivery if the seller is not a merchant.
-
Lien Searches. Buyers should conduct a UCC lien search through the Alabama Secretary of State's office to verify there are no outstanding security interests on the property.
